Bradford Public Library
The Bradford Public Library District, established in October 1900 by a group of local women, aims to foster a love for reading and expand the community's access to educational resources. It offers a diverse range of services including youth and adult programs, digital media access, and various reading resources to enrich the lives of its patrons.
Dedicated to inclusivity, the library ensures that its services are accessible to all members of the community, actively working to comply with the Web Content Accessibility Guidelines. With a mission rooted in transparency and community engagement, the Bradford Public Library serves as a vital resource for information, learning, and cultural enrichment.
